A Drunken British Tourist Broke the ATM screen as He Couldn’t Withdraw the Money
A Drunken British Tourist Broke the ATM screen as He Couldn’t Withdraw the Money
Kampot: According to Koh Santepheap Daily News, A drunken British tourist broke ATM screen nearby the beach located in Kompong Bay district, Kampot city. The incident happened around 7:00 pm on 29 December 2015.
According to witnesses, there was a foreigner went to withdraw the money in the ATM. Then, it seemed like he couldn’t withdraw the money, so he punched the screen a few times which caused it to be broken. The security guard saw it and reported it to police to arrest the foreigner.

Boozed-up Brit accused in Kampot ATM attack
A British national was arrested in Kampot town on Tuesday night after allegedly attacking a cash machine following what police said was a night of heavy drinking.
Paul Connor, 34, had visited an Acleda Bank ATM hoping to prolong his night on the tiles. But the machine had other ideas, eating his card and sending him into a rage.
